Why Upgrade Your Locks?

Lock upgrades are important for numerous factors. Here are some compelling points that highlight the need for enhanced security:

  1. Increased Security Threats: With the increase in criminal activity rates, homes and organizations need to proactively manage their security.
  2. Use and Tear: Locks can deteriorate with time. Rust, deterioration, and internal wear can lower their efficiency.
  3. Technological Advancements: New locking mechanisms use features that older designs can not, such as keypad entry, smartphone integration, and remote gain access to.
  4. Insurance coverage Requirements: Some insurance provider provide discounts or may need particular lock types for valid claims.
  5. Lost Keys: If keys are lost or taken, it's prudent to update locks to prevent unapproved access.

The Types of Lock Upgrades Available

When thinking about a lock upgrade, it's vital to comprehend the types of locks offered. Below is a table that details the numerous lock types and their functions:

Lock TypeDescriptionProsCons
Deadbolt LocksDurable locks that use superior security by extending a bolt into the door frame.High security, challenging to selectInstallation can be intricate
Smart LocksElectronic locks that can be managed by means of smartphones or biometrics.Practical, remote gain access toNeeds batteries; can be hacked
Keyless EntryLocks that do not need a physical secret, utilizing PIN codes rather.No secrets to lose, quick accessDanger of forgotten codes
Mortise LocksLocks that fit within a pocket cut into the edge of the door.Robust, lastingMore costly; needs experienced installation
Chain LocksBasic locks that provide an extra layer of security for doors.Economical, simple to set upMinimal security; not for exterior doors
Web cam LocksTypical in filing cabinets and lockers, these are generally key-operated.Compact, helpful for cabinetsLow security level for doors

How to Choose the Right Lock Upgrade

When picking a lock upgrade, consider the following elements:

  1. Budget: Determine just how much you are willing to spend. Quality locks typically include a higher cost, however they can save cash in the long run through minimized insurance coverage premiums and less burglaries.
  2. Function: Different locks serve various purposes; choose locks based on whether they will be utilized for exterior doors, interior doors, cabinets, or safes.
  3. Setup: Some locks require professional setup, while others can be set up by a DIY lover. Evaluate your skills and convenience level.
  4. Security Needs: Evaluate the level of security required. For high-risk locations, consider deadbolts or clever locks with alarm.
  5. Aesthetics: Locks been available in various designs and finishes. Guarantee that the lock design aligns with the overall décor of the home.

FAQs about Lock Upgrades

Q1: How typically should I upgrade my locks?

A: It is recommended to assess your locks every five years and update them if they reveal signs of wear or end up being outdated.

Q2: Can I set up a brand-new lock myself?

A: Many locks can be installed as a DIY task, especially knob locks and deadbolts. However, for more complex systems like wise locks, expert setup might be advisable.

Q3: Are smart locks safe?

A: Yes, when set up properly and with updated software application, clever locks can supply a high level of security. Constantly search for locks with encryption and robust user reviews.

Q4: What should I do if I lose my secrets?

A: If secrets are lost, it's important to upgrade the locks immediately to avoid unapproved gain access to. Additionally, think about re-keying locks if you do not wish to change them completely.

Q5: Will upgrading my locks impact my home insurance?

A: Yes, lots of insurance companies provide discount rates to house owners with updated security systems. It's best to inspect with your insurance company for specific requirements.
